UK officials pressured to drop IP demands in India trade talks

The Trade Justice Movement and over 50 UK-based civil society organisations and individuals sent this open letter to United Kingdom Prime Minister Rishi Sunak, urging him to publicly commit that the UK-India Free Trade Agreement will not gut the public health safeguards that are in India’s intellectual property laws, nor undermine global access to affordable generic medicines.
